Europe is undertaking a set of leading initiatives to accelerate this progress. On one hand, the European Commission is funding its own Exascale initiative, currently represented by three complementary research projects focusing on hardware-software co-design, scalable system software, and novel system architectures. On the other hand, Intel is conducting a number of collaborative research activities through its European Exascale Labs. The session will present the advances and results from these initiatives and open the floor to discuss the results and the approach taken.
